Calcium Efflux Activity of Plasma Membrane Ca(2+) ATPase-4 (PMCA4) Mediates Cell Cycle Progression in Vascular Smooth Muscle Cells
We explored the role played by plasma membrane calcium ATPase-4 (PMCA4) and its alternative splice variants in the cell cycle of vascular smooth muscle cells (VSMC).
